Summary

West Middle School is a public middle school serving 794 students in grades 6-8 in Rockford, Illinois, which is part of the Rockford School District 205. The school consistently performs below the district and state averages on standardized tests, with only 22.2% of students proficient or better in English Language Arts and 8.1% in Mathematics, compared to 32.8% and 20.1% for the district, respectively.

West Middle School struggles to effectively serve certain student subgroups, ranking in the bottom 50% of Illinois middle schools for African American, Hispanic, White, Multi-racial, Low Socioeconomic Status, and Disabled students. The school also has high chronic absenteeism rates, ranging from 25.4% to 62.8% over the past few years, which is significantly higher than the state average. While the school's spending per student has increased from $12,495 in 2020-2021 to $18,511 in 2023-2024, it is still below the state average.
